Economy & Jobs

St. François Xavier residents earn a median household income of $120,000 , which is 60% above the national average of $75,149. Per capita income is $65,800. The unemployment rate stands at 5.6% (56% above the U.S. rate of 3.6%). 5.2% of residents live below the poverty line. The area is home to 45 business establishments.

Housing & Cost of Living

The median home value in St. François Xavier is $448,000 , 59% above the national median of $281,900. Median rent is $785/month, with 12.8% of renters spending more than 30% of income on housing.

Education

14.5% of adults in St. François Xavier hold a bachelor's degree or higher (57% below the national average). 32.6% have completed high school.

Climate & Weather

St. François Xavier has an average annual temperature of 37°F (3°C). Winters average -1°F in January while summers reach 67°F in July. The area gets 297 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 21.5 inches.
